GA16DE GXE. While replacing hoses and rear motor mount. I found what was left of the bushing for the Rack and Pinion. I purchased replacement bushings came with two one circular and the other non circular with a triangular point. Need to know how to replace them. Just before doing so on my own since the passenger side of the Rack and Pinion, I can see that there are total of three bolts lined vertically holding up a metal band looped holding the Rack and Pinion. If that's what I need to do in order to grease the bushing with suspension grease and loosen bolts to get the bushing around and through the metal loop/strap then tighten up? Wanted to know if I'm on the right track.

You are on the right track. The non circular one goes on the drivers side. I attached the process for replacing the rack. It includes these bushings. Let us know if you need more info. Thanks
